What is PEMDAS?

It is an order or sequence in which mathematical expressions should be solved. It solves mathematical expressions by remembering the correct order of operations. PEMDAS goes alternatively with the names BEDMAS and BODMAS.

PEMDAS stands for:

  • P show Parentheses “()
  • E show Exponent “^
  • M represent Multiplication “* or ×
  • D represent Division “/ or ÷
  • A used for Addition “+
  • S used for Subtraction “-

You are also familiar with related acronyms like PEMDAS, which are used to solve the expression by using the rules of order of operations such as: BEDMAS, BODMAS, GEMDAS, and MDAS.

In these acronyms, “B” is used for brackets that represent the same parentheses, and “order” for exponents. But in “GEMDAS”, G is taken for grouping that shows the parentheses or brackets.

How to Simplify Equations With PEMDAS?

It is better to use our above PEMDAS calculator. But to solve math problems manually by using PEMDAS, start from left and end on right. In the solution, solve the operation 1st that comes first in the expression to move from left to right.

Firstly, solved the brackets if it present in the equations or expressions, and so on. One thing that should be kept in mind is that multiplication and division are solved side by side. This is the reason we see division before multiplication in BODMAS.

Similarly, addition and subtraction are solved side by side, there are no preferences in them. To understand how to use the PEMDAS rule to solve expressions, see the examples below with detailed steps.

Example 1:

Solve (2-1)5 - 2 + 4. 

Note: Use PEMDAS Rule.

Solution:

Step 1: Solve the parentheses.

 = (2-1)

 = 1

Step 2: Now solve multiplication and division.

 = (1)5 - 2 + 4

 = 5 -2 + 4

Step 3: At the end, solve + and -.

= 5 -2 + 4

= 3 + 4

= 7

Example 2:

Solve the expression “10 / 2 × (9+2)” using order of operations.

Solution:

Step 1: Solve the parenthesis.

= 10 / 2 × (9+2)

= 10 / 2 × 11

Step 2: Now solve multiplication and division.

= 10 / 2 × 11

= 5 × 11

= 55
